 Ingredients: Pink Chia Pudding        

 1 Cup Fresh or Frozen Raspberries                               

 1 Cup Soy Milk    

 3 Tbsp. Maple Syrup (Try using Smartfruit Superfruit All-Stars)              

 ¼ Cup Soy Yogurt

 2 Tsp. Pink Pitaya Powder (Dissolve in 2 Tsp. Water)       

 ¼ Cup Chia Seeds

 1 Cup Dairy-free White Chocolate        

 1.5 Tsp. Pink Pitaya Powder     

 

 Preparation:

  1. Start by adding berries, milk, sweetener, yogurt, and dissolved pitaya powder to a blender
  2. Blend until smooth
  3. Pour mixture into a bowl and add in chia seeds; stir well then let rest in refrigerator for at least 1-2 hours or overnight *Stirring occasionally until in reaches a pudding-like consistency
  4. For the chocolate cups, combine melted white chocolate and pitaya powder
  5. Add chocolate to a silicone mold, then fill with chia pudding mixture
  6. Refrigerate until ready to serve
  7. Before serving top fresh raspberries, pomegranate arils, or fruit of your choice!
